Como a tecnologia blockchain revoluciona a geração de números aleatórios

robot
Geração do resumo em andamento

A geração de números aleatórios tem sido há muito tempo um componente crucial em diversos campos, desde a tomada de decisões até a criptografia. Com o advento da tecnologia blockchain, esse processo passou por uma transformação significativa, oferecendo novas possibilidades e soluções para problemas tradicionais.

O papel da aleatoriedade na Web3

No ecossistema Web3, a geração de números aleatórios confiáveis é fundamental para diversas aplicações:

  • DeFi (Finanças Descentralizadas): Para a distribuição equitativa de tokens e a seleção de participantes em sorteios.
  • NFTs (Tokens Não Fungíveis): Na criação de características únicas e na atribuição de raridades.
  • Jogos blockchain: Para garantir resultados imprevisíveis e justos em jogos de azar descentralizados.

Tecnologia blockchain vs. métodos tradicionais

A tecnologia blockchain oferece várias vantagens sobre os métodos tradicionais de geração de números aleatórios:

Aspeto Blockchain Métodos Tradicionais
Transparência Processo verificável publicamente Opaco, difícil de auditar
Descentralização Não depende de uma única fonte Centralizado, vulnerável a manipulação
Imutabilidade Resultados registrados permanentemente Potencialmente alteráveis

Implementação da aleatoriedade na blockchain

Existem várias abordagens para gerar números aleatórios em um ambiente blockchain:

  1. Oráculos de aleatoriedade: Serviços externos que fornecem números aleatórios verificáveis.
  2. Funções de hash de blocos: Utilizam dados de blocos futuros para gerar aleatoriedade.
  3. Protocolos de compromisso: Os participantes contribuem para a geração de um número aleatório coletivo.

Aplicações práticas no ecossistema Web3

A geração de números aleatórios baseada em blockchain tem inúmeras aplicações:

  • Loterias descentralizadas: Garantem transparência e equidade nos sorteios.
  • Atribuição de staking: Distribuição justa de recompensas em pools de staking.
  • Geração de chaves criptográficas: Melhora a segurança na criação de carteiras e assinaturas digitais.

Desafios e considerações futuras

Apesar das suas vantagens, a geração de números aleatórios em blockchain enfrenta desafios:

  • Escalabilidade: Garantir a eficiência em redes blockchain de alto desempenho.
  • Latência: Reduzir o tempo necessário para gerar e verificar números aleatórios.
  • Resistência à manipulação: Prevenir a exploração por parte de mineradores ou validadores mal-intencionados.

A evolução contínua da tecnologia blockchain promete abordar esses desafios, levando a uma nova era de geração de números aleatórios mais confiável, transparente e descentralizada.

Ver original
Esta página pode conter conteúdo de terceiros, que é fornecido apenas para fins informativos (não para representações/garantias) e não deve ser considerada como um endosso de suas opiniões pela Gate nem como aconselhamento financeiro ou profissional. Consulte a Isenção de responsabilidade para obter detalhes.
  • Recompensa
  • Comentário
  • Repostar
  • Compartilhar
Comentário
0/400
Sem comentários
  • Marcar
Negocie criptomoedas a qualquer hora e em qualquer lugar
qrCode
Escaneie o código para baixar o app da Gate
Comunidade
Português (Brasil)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)